Responsibilities
Management:
*Ensure timely planning and modification of program activities from inception to end of grants in accordance with approved proposal.
*Ensure smooth organization and timely implementation of program components according to agreed-upon work plans and available funds.
*Assure quality programming related implementation for health activities through identifying, developing and adapting necessary measuring tools and instruments to monitor activities in the field as assess success .
*Ensure the adherence and commitment of IMC Damascus staff ethical, moral and professional standards as set by IMC Syria program.
*Work closely with administrative, logistics and procurement, human resource, and finance departments ensuring adherence to Global IMC logistic, finance and Human resources standards

Monitoring and supervision:
* In coordination with monitoring and evaluation units ensure monitoring and evaluation procedures are applied and followed.
* Conduct regular visits for program sites ensuring quality of services, accurate data collection and verification of activities implementation according to set plan, IMC Guidelines/standards, and proposals
* Participate in Procurement plan, pipelines, and budget realignment
* Participate in recruitment and hiring staff, ensure it follow IMC Syria Guidelines, and requirement including the National labor Law adherence

Program development:
* Contribute to identifying and proposing new/scaled up health related interventions to be supported by IMC based on data collected in reference to the needs of IDPs and vulnerable host population.
* Actively participate in program development and proposal writing as required.

Staff development:
* Identify staff training needs and actively seek for national staff capacity building
*Ensure all documentations reference to training of staff members are timely and properly filled and filed.

Reporting:
* Provide regular updates and reports to Medical Director and relevant departments senior staff as required
* Contribute to donor reports and internal IMC reports according to reporting schedule
* Report any security/safety incidence immediately
* Participate in Program development, and Implementation plan.

Coordination:
* Participate in working group meetings or ensure IMC staff participation
* Conduct regular meetings with SARC
* Coordinate with the Local Authorities including MOH, Governorate, relief committee, and others, including updating and requesting for approvals for implementation.

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in social sciences, public health, community health, gender and development or related field. Medical Doctor preferable.
- 3 years' experience in health program management including monitoring and evaluation.
- Awareness and knowledge of health issues in general and their relevance to the humanitarian emergency and post-conflict recovery setting. Prior training is preferable.
- Experience working in the health response of the ongoing crisis situation inside Syria.
- Experience in program coordination and community participatory methods for community development and mobilization.

Specific Vacancy Requirements
* Fluency in speaking and writing English and Arabic.
* Conducts work with the highest level of integrity. Communicates these values to staff and to partners and requires them to adhere to these values.
* Promotes and encourages a culture of compliance and ethics throughout International Medical Corps. As applicable to the position, maintains a clear understanding of International Medical Corps'; and donor compliance and ethics standards and adheres to those standards.
